Chapter A Troubleshooting Troubleshooting the Appliance Table A-2 Debug Logger Zone Names (continued) Zone Name cmgr cplane csi Description Card Manager service zone1 Control Plane zone2 CIDS Servlet Interface3 ctlTransSource Outbound control transactions zone intfc Interface zone nac ARC zone rep Reputation zone sched Automatic update scheduler zone sensorApp Analysis Engine zone tls SSL and TLS zone 1. The Card Manager service is used on the AIP SSM to exchange control and state information between modules in the chassis. 2. The Control Plane is the transport communications layer used by Card Manager on the AIP SSM. 3. The CIDS servlet interface is the interface layer between the CIDS web server and the servlets. For More Information To learn more about the IPS Logger service, refer to Logger. Directing cidLog Messages to SysLog It might be useful to direct cidLog messages to syslog. To direct cidLog messages to syslog, follow these steps: Step 1 Step 2 Go to the idsRoot/etc/log.conf file. Make the following changes: a. Set [logApp] enabled=false Comment out the enabled=true because enabled=false is the default. b. Set [drain/main] type=syslog The following example shows the logging configuration file: timemode=local ;timemode=utc [logApp] ;enabled=true ;-------- FIFO parameters -------fifoName=logAppFifo fifoSizeInK=240 ;-------- logApp zone and drain parameters -------zoneAndDrainName=logApp fileName=main.log fileMaxSizeInK=500 [zone/Cid] OL-18504-01 Cisco Intrusion Prevention System Appliance and Module Installation Guide for IPS 7.0 A-51
